The default setting for the DIP switch is SW1 ââ?¬â?? SW4 ON. This will scale a MAF sensor output of 0-7Vdc to the full input range of the PCMââ?¬â?¢s A/D input of 0-5Vdc. This setting will only be used under the most extreme circumstances. If the unit is installed with the DIP switches in the default configuration and tuning changes are not made the car will be dangerously lean and may not run at all. As a general rule, do the LEAST amount of scaling possible for your application. Remember that the more you scale the MAF curve down, the more resolution you give up in the low-flow portion of the curve and that this may affect driveability.

It scales pretty severely also. Check out their settings...

Code:

Vin to Vout - Scalar Value - HP ('03 Cobra with stock 90mm MAF)
5V to 5V 1.0000000 545
5.5V to 5V 0.7635203 714
6V to 5V 0.5941677 918
6.5V to 5V 0.4714800 1156
7V to 5V 0.3804597 1433
